diff options
author | waynedunican <wayne.dunican@est.tech> | 2023-03-01 09:07:31 +0000 |
---|---|---|
committer | waynedunican <wayne.dunican@est.tech> | 2023-03-31 09:22:52 +0100 |
commit | e4ff7e58336dfb4fa6699e0a37dbbb298a129ada (patch) | |
tree | 628b9dd05e310075d45af382655142fdcd419908 /compose/metrics | |
parent | 181e6c525c5e05bbb3e580fd0793b8332200659d (diff) |
Add SLA Validations for Apex-PDP
- Add multiple apex microservice SLA tests
- Add single instance apex SLA tests
- Single instance SLA tests to be ran as part of CSIT runs
- Multiple microservice will not be ran as part of CSITs due to high resource consumption
- Multiple microservice SLA test results can be found in the linked JIRA
- Added setup scripts for multiple instance SLA tests
- nginx added for load balancing purposes for multiple apex instances
Issue-ID: POLICY-4530
Issue-ID: POLICY-4164
Change-Id: Ib86e96c57f4b7bf2b4f5e930fd7d4a3805b50687
Signed-off-by: Wayne Dunican <wayne.dunican@est.tech>
Signed-off-by: adheli.tavares <adheli.tavares@est.tech>
Diffstat (limited to 'compose/metrics')
-rw-r--r-- | compose/metrics/prometheus.yml | 124 |
1 files changed, 60 insertions, 64 deletions
diff --git a/compose/metrics/prometheus.yml b/compose/metrics/prometheus.yml index 789cfc2a..c3d87f57 100644 --- a/compose/metrics/prometheus.yml +++ b/compose/metrics/prometheus.yml @@ -24,78 +24,74 @@ global: # Alertmanager configuration alerting: alertmanagers: - - static_configs: - - targets: - # - alertmanager:9093 + - static_configs: + - targets: + # - alertmanager:9093 # scrape config scrape_configs: - - job_name: "api-metrics" - metrics_path: /policy/api/v1/metrics - static_configs: - - targets: ["policy-api:6969"] - basic_auth: - username: "policyadmin" - password: "zb!XztG34" +- job_name: "api-metrics" + metrics_path: /policy/api/v1/metrics + static_configs: + - targets: ["policy-api:6969"] + basic_auth: + username: "policyadmin" + password: "zb!XztG34" - - job_name: "pap-metrics" - metrics_path: /policy/pap/v1/metrics - static_configs: - - targets: ["policy-pap:6969"] - basic_auth: - username: "policyadmin" - password: "zb!XztG34" +- job_name: "pap-metrics" + metrics_path: /policy/pap/v1/metrics + static_configs: + - targets: ["policy-pap:6969"] + basic_auth: + username: "policyadmin" + password: "zb!XztG34" - - job_name: "apex-pdp-metrics" - static_configs: - - targets: - - "policy-apex-pdp:6969" - basic_auth: - username: "policyadmin" - password: "zb!XztG34" +- job_name: "apex-pdp-metrics" + static_configs: + - targets: + - "policy-apex-pdp:6969" + basic_auth: + username: "policyadmin" + password: "zb!XztG34" - - job_name: "drools-apps-metrics" - static_configs: - - targets: - - "drools-apps:9696" - basic_auth: - username: "demo@people.osaaf.org" - password: "demo123456!" +- job_name: "drools-apps-metrics" + static_configs: + - targets: + - "drools-apps:9696" + basic_auth: + username: "demo@people.osaaf.org" + password: "demo123456!" - - job_name: "drools-pdp-metrics" - static_configs: - - targets: - - "drools:9696" - basic_auth: - username: "demo@people.osaaf.org" - password: "demo123456!" +- job_name: "drools-pdp-metrics" + static_configs: + - targets: + - "drools:9696" + basic_auth: + username: "demo@people.osaaf.org" + password: "demo123456!" - - job_name: "distribution-metrics" - static_configs: - - targets: - - "policy-distribution:6969" - basic_auth: - username: "policyadmin" - password: "zb!XztG34" +- job_name: "distribution-metrics" + static_configs: + - targets: + - "policy-distribution:6969" + basic_auth: + username: "policyadmin" + password: "zb!XztG34" - - job_name: "xacml-pdp-metrics" - static_configs: - - targets: - - "policy-xacml-pdp:6969" - basic_auth: - username: "policyadmin" - password: "zb!XztG34" +- job_name: "xacml-pdp-metrics" + static_configs: + - targets: + - "policy-xacml-pdp:6969" + basic_auth: + username: "policyadmin" + password: "zb!XztG34" - - job_name: "acm-metrics" - metrics_path: "/onap/policy/clamp/acm/prometheus" - static_configs: - - targets: - - "policy-clamp-runtime-acm:6969" - basic_auth: - username: "runtimeUser" - password: "zb!XztG34" - - - job_name: "node" - static_configs: - - targets: ["node-exporter:9100"] +- job_name: "acm-metrics" + metrics_path: "/onap/policy/clamp/acm/prometheus" + static_configs: + - targets: + - "policy-clamp-runtime-acm:6969" + basic_auth: + username: "runtimeUser" + password: "zb!XztG34" |